The System of Selection

The formulation of Request for Proposal (RFP) evaluation criteria represents a foundational act of system design. It is the process of creating the logical framework through which an organization identifies and selects a strategic partner. A failure in this initial design phase introduces systemic risk that propagates through the entire lifecycle of a project, procurement, or partnership. The consequences of poorly defined criteria extend far beyond a suboptimal vendor choice; they manifest as operational friction, cost overruns, and a fundamental misalignment between the procured solution and the organization’s strategic intent.

Viewing the criteria as the core operating code for the selection process itself is the first step toward mitigating these risks. The objective is to construct a system that is robust, transparent, and precisely calibrated to the unique operational and strategic requirements of the organization.

At its core, the challenge is one of translating abstract organizational goals into a set of quantifiable and qualitative metrics. This translation is where the most critical pitfalls emerge. Vague aspirations such as “enhanced efficiency” or “improved productivity” are without value in an evaluation context unless they are attached to concrete, measurable key performance indicators. The criteria must function as a precise instrument for differentiation, allowing the evaluation committee to discern meaningful variations between vendor proposals.

Without this precision, the selection process degrades into a subjective exercise, susceptible to cognitive biases and internal political pressures. The architectural integrity of the entire procurement rests upon the intellectual rigor applied at this stage.

The design of RFP evaluation criteria is an exercise in creating a robust system for strategic partner selection, where ambiguity in the initial framework introduces cascading risks throughout the project lifecycle.

The process is further complicated by inherent human and organizational tendencies. A well-documented phenomenon is the ‘lower bid bias,’ where evaluators, even when assessing qualitative aspects, are unconsciously swayed by the lowest price. This cognitive shortcut can lead to the selection of an inexpensive, yet ultimately inadequate, solution.

A robust evaluation framework anticipates and corrects for such biases through its very structure, for instance, by mandating a multi-stage evaluation where qualitative and technical merits are assessed independently of price. The system, therefore, must be designed for resilience against both ambiguous inputs and flawed human processing, ensuring the final decision is a direct function of the organization’s stated strategic objectives.

Calibrating the Evaluative Lens

A strategic approach to defining RFP evaluation criteria begins with the principle that the criteria are a direct extension of organizational strategy. Before any metric is defined, a deep alignment with the project’s core objectives must be established. This involves a disciplined process of stakeholder engagement to distill broad goals into a finite set of critical success factors.

These factors then become the pillars upon which the entire evaluation framework is built. The strategic failure to connect a criterion to a specific business outcome results in a metric that measures activity without measuring progress, a common pitfall that leads to selecting a vendor that is compliant on paper but ineffective in practice.

The weighting of evaluation criteria is the primary mechanism for signaling strategic priorities to both the internal evaluation team and external bidders. A common misstep is the disproportionate weighting of price. While fiscal prudence is essential, an overemphasis on cost can systematically devalue critical factors like technical capability, service quality, and long-term partnership potential. Best practices suggest that price should constitute between 20-30% of the total score, a calibration that balances cost-consciousness with a focus on value and performance.

Deviating from this range should be a conscious strategic decision, justified by the specific context of the procurement. For instance, for a commoditized product, a higher price weighting might be appropriate, whereas for a complex technology implementation, technical and support criteria should dominate.

Comparative Weighting Models

The allocation of weights within an RFP evaluation framework is a declaration of an organization’s priorities. Different models can be applied depending on the nature of the procurement. Understanding their strategic implications is essential for designing a system that yields the desired outcome.

Weighting Model Description Strategic Application Potential Pitfall
Value-Focused Model Prioritizes technical merit, vendor experience, and service quality over cost. Price typically weighted at 20-30%. Complex projects, technology implementations, and long-term strategic partnerships where performance and reliability are paramount. May result in a higher initial acquisition cost if budget constraints are not clearly communicated to vendors.
Cost-Centric Model Assigns a high weight (40%+) to the price component, making it the dominant factor in the decision. Procurement of commoditized goods or services where differentiation in quality or performance is minimal among suppliers. High risk of selecting an under-performing solution or vendor, leading to long-term costs that exceed initial savings.
Compliance-Driven Model Places heavy emphasis on mandatory requirements, security, and adherence to specific standards. Often uses a pass/fail gateway for these criteria. Public sector procurement, regulated industries (e.g. finance, healthcare), or projects with strict legal and regulatory constraints. Can stifle innovation if the criteria are too prescriptive and focus solely on replicating existing processes rather than improving them.

Structuring for Clarity and Consistency

With a strategically aligned and weighted set of criteria, the next step is to architect the scoring mechanism. This requires the development of a clear, granular evaluation scale. A three-point scale, for example, often fails to provide sufficient differentiation, compressing distinct proposals into similar scores.

A five or ten-point scale offers the necessary resolution for evaluators to make meaningful distinctions. Each point on the scale must be accompanied by a descriptive rubric that defines what constitutes a “1,” a “3,” or a “5.” This rubric is the key to ensuring scoring consistency across multiple evaluators, transforming a subjective judgment into a more objective, evidence-based assessment.

  • Scoring Scale Definition ▴ Establish a scale (e.g. 1-5 or 1-10) with clear, qualitative descriptors for each level. For example, a score of 5 on “Technical Approach” might be defined as “Exceeds requirements; presents an innovative, efficient, and low-risk methodology,” while a 3 is “Meets all stated requirements.”
  • Mandatory vs. Scored Criteria ▴ Differentiate between requirements that are essential for consideration and those that will be used to compare qualified vendors. Mandatory requirements (e.g. licensing, insurance) should be treated as a pass/fail gateway that a vendor must clear before its proposal is scored.
  • Qualitative and Quantitative Mix ▴ A balanced evaluation includes both quantitative metrics (e.g. price, performance benchmarks) and qualitative criteria (e.g. project management approach, customer references). The scoring rubric must provide a clear methodology for assessing both.

The Mechanics of a Defensible Evaluation

The execution of an RFP evaluation is the operational test of its design. A well-designed system can still fail if its implementation is flawed. The primary objective during execution is to ensure a fair, transparent, and defensible selection process. This begins with the formal training of the evaluation committee.

Each member must understand not only the criteria but also the scoring rubric and the process for handling discrepancies. This initial calibration is vital for mitigating individual biases and ensuring that all proposals are assessed against the same consistent standard.

A meticulously designed evaluation framework is only as robust as its execution; its integrity hinges on a disciplined process, from evaluator training to structured consensus meetings.

A critical execution step is the management of cognitive biases, particularly the ‘lower bid bias.’ A proven technique to counter this is a two-stage evaluation. In the first stage, the evaluation committee assesses all non-price components of the proposals ▴ technical solution, qualifications, management plan ▴ and finalizes these scores. Only after the qualitative and technical scoring is complete is the price proposal revealed.

This sequential process prevents the price from unduly influencing the assessment of a proposal’s intrinsic merit. An alternative approach involves assigning price evaluation to a separate, specialized committee, completely isolating the technical evaluators from cost considerations.

Operationalizing the Scoring Rubric

The scoring rubric is the primary tool for the evaluation committee. It translates the abstract criteria into a concrete set of instructions for assessment. A well-constructed rubric is the foundation of a defensible decision.

It provides a documented trail of evidence showing how the committee arrived at its conclusion. The following table provides a simplified example for a single evaluation criterion.

Score Descriptor Evidence Required Example Evaluator Notes
5 – Exceptional Proposal significantly exceeds requirements. Demonstrates a deep understanding of our needs and offers a highly innovative, low-risk, and value-added solution. Specific examples of innovation, detailed risk mitigation strategies, and clearly articulated value-add beyond the RFP’s scope. “Vendor A’s use of a predictive analytics module for inventory management is a clear differentiator that addresses our stated goal of reducing waste. This was not requested but adds significant value.”
3 – Meets Requirements Proposal addresses all stated requirements in a complete and satisfactory manner. The proposed approach is sound and meets industry standards. Direct mapping of proposal features to each RFP requirement. No significant flaws or omissions. “Vendor B’s proposal meets all functional requirements as listed in Appendix C. The project plan is logical and follows the requested timeline.”
1 – Unsatisfactory Proposal fails to meet key requirements or contains significant flaws, omissions, or inaccuracies. The proposed solution carries a high degree of risk. Identification of specific, unaddressed mandatory requirements. Lack of detail in critical areas. “Vendor C failed to provide the required security certifications and their proposed implementation timeline is unrealistic, indicating a lack of understanding of the project’s complexity.”

Fostering Consensus and Finalizing Selection

The simple averaging of evaluator scores is a common but flawed practice. A significant variance in scores for a particular criterion often indicates a deeper issue, such as a misunderstanding of the proposal, a lack of clarity in the scoring criteria, or a particular evaluator’s bias. Instead of averaging, these variances should trigger a consensus meeting.

The goal of this meeting is not to force agreement, but to understand the source of the disagreement. A facilitator should guide the discussion, focusing on the evidence presented in the proposals.

This process of discussion and debate leads to a more robust and well-documented decision. Evaluators may adjust their scores based on the insights of their peers, leading to a final set of scores that more accurately reflects the collective, considered judgment of the committee. This process is essential for the following reasons:

  1. Error Correction ▴ It allows the committee to catch and correct misunderstandings. One evaluator may have missed a key detail in a proposal that another can point out.
  2. Bias Mitigation ▴ Open discussion can surface and challenge individual biases, leading to a more objective group assessment.
  3. Improved Defensibility ▴ A documented process of consensus-building provides a strong defense against challenges to the procurement decision. It shows that the selection was the result of a deliberate and thoughtful process.

Ultimately, the final selection should be a direct output of this disciplined, multi-stage process. The winning vendor is the one that has demonstrated the highest value as defined by the pre-established, strategically weighted criteria and validated through a rigorous, collaborative evaluation. The integrity of the execution phase ensures that the promise of a well-designed evaluation system is fully realized.

The Evaluation Framework as a Living System

The principles and mechanics discussed constitute a blueprint for a robust selection system. Yet, the framework itself should not be static. Each RFP cycle is an opportunity for organizational learning. The procurement function should incorporate a formal post-mortem process to analyze the effectiveness of the evaluation criteria.

Did the selected vendor deliver on the promised value? Were there unforeseen challenges that the criteria failed to anticipate? This feedback loop transforms the evaluation process from a series of discrete events into a continuously improving system. It is this commitment to iterative refinement that builds a true, lasting strategic capability in an organization’s procurement and partnership activities. The ultimate goal is an evaluation architecture that is not only defensible and efficient but also intelligent and adaptive to the evolving needs of the enterprise.
